Transaction 53dbfa0305d04ca2d311b2d6d2bebd0fc53ccd6eaadc4b131c57f365f0f653e8

81 Input
2 Outputs
  • 53dbfa0305d04ca2d311b2d6d2bebd0fc53ccd6eaadc4b131c57f365f0f653e8:0
  • value  551563
    address  37XbceU1vCGuQ6XT71eXgZmjNs15r7jAyD
  • 53dbfa0305d04ca2d311b2d6d2bebd0fc53ccd6eaadc4b131c57f365f0f653e8:1
  • value  4216
    address  1PmDDGGSambPuSV4nqX4amJmsx7b41gcvj